April 2022 Income Tax Threshold £12,570
April 2031 Income Tax Threshold £12,570

Should be about £16,970.

Meaning every person earning £16,970 or more is paying £1,231.86 more in tax.

Threshold freezes are a tax on the poorest.

Budget 2025

From April 2027, 2 percentage point increase to the basic, higher, additional rates of saving income tax, increasing them to 22, 42 and 47 per cent respectively.

Savers to pay more income tax. Tax free personal allowance and income tax thresholds remain frozen. Young savers penalised.
